I thought it was a pretty good movie that talked about how the racist assassin Byron De La Beckwith was put to justice for the killing of civil rights activist Medgar Evers. It is a good history about the civil rights movement and the ignorant racist that were around in the south back in the old days.

It also had a good cast in it. For people interested in history and the civil rights movement and all should watch this movie.

This review of Ghosts of Mississippi (1996) was written by on 20 Jun 2010.
